Transaction 63ae2d5758211e1d90f56f3b44120c123463382bb01af876d30cee160c1a9887
1 Input
1 Output
-
63ae2d5758211e1d90f56f3b44120c123463382bb01af876d30cee160c1a9887:0
- value
- 364447
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 404c2a1efdcbb7f03756c0c5da1deff7ba687a01 OP_EQUAL
- address
- 37YzQpqZ6MdQZ211CXqrJV8hWEJCY9EY7X